Is it cheaper to hire internally or externally?

Hiring an internal candidate is typically quicker and less expensive because you don’t have to pay to post a job ad or pay a recruiter to source candidates. It’s a best practice to conduct interviews consistently and speak with references, regardless of whether you are hiring internally or externally.

How does on campus recruiting work?

On-Campus Recruiting (OCR) is a recruiting method used by employers seeking to hire interns and entry-level employees from some of the brightest and most talented college students. Each year, employers recruit on campus through: On-campus recruiting. Career fairs and networking events.

How much do campus recruiters make?

Based on data from Glassdoor, PayScale, and Salary.com, most campus recruiters make between $60,162 and $80,172 a year. The average salary nationwide falls closer to $65,000 a year, with the high end reaching $87,000 annually and the low end bottoming out around $48,000.

What is the best method in external recruitment?

Job boards Job boards are probably the most popular and effective method of external recruitment, as they allow hiring managers to reach a wider audience. What’s more, as job boards make it easier to actually apply for the position, they can also help speed up the hiring process.

Do employers recruit students on campus?

Reality: Many employers who interview on campus will talk to students from any major. Insurance companies, car-rental agencies, some consulting firms and other organizations are well-known for recruiting students from across the spectrum.

Do employers prefer to hire internally?

While some companies prefer internal hires, the majority don’t necessarily favor existing talent for open positions, according to American Management Association. The most crucial factor when a company is hiring is whether the employee is suitable for that role.

How do I become a good college recruiter?

Best Practices for Recruiting New College Graduates

  1. Build, develop, manage, and maintain campus relationships.
  2. Set realistic recruiting goals.
  3. Choose your target schools carefully.
  4. Send the right people to campus.
  5. Communicate with students about the process.
  6. Measure and analyze your results—and adjust accordingly.
  7. Feed your full-time hiring with an internship program.

When would an employer use external recruitment?

As SHRM notes, “Employers also use external recruitment to attract individuals with the necessary skill sets, especially when seeking to grow the business or take it in a different direction.” 2) Hiring externally opens the company to a much larger pool of prospects to choose from.
